House looted twice in a Month at Belonia : Debt ridden Man's land-selling money taken away
PHOTO : Victim Amar Banik. TIWN Pic May 10, 2021

BELONIA (South Tripura), May 10 (TIWN): The incident of burglary in a same house twice in a month has created panic in local's minds. Despite informing the Belonia police and administration, nothing is happening. The incident took place in Amtali area of Belonia under Bharatchandra Nagar block.

The victim house owner, Amar Banik a Goldsmith by profession, his house was looted by thieves twice in a month. It is known that the man, Amar Banik lives alone in his wife as his wife passed away one and half years ago.

He was debt ridden after his daughter's marriage and old his land but that cash amount has been taken away.

It is known that unlike everyday on Monday the gold trader, Amar Banik locked his house and went to the shop. By taking the opportunity of an empty house a group of thieves raided the house and looted huge amounts of gold ornament cash, along with expensive items.

With extremely saddened the victim man said few days before he sold a plot to clear out the debt, but that amount was also stolen by thieves

When the man returned to home on Monday evening found his room's boundary tin fence was cut and windows were broken. It was immediately informed to Belonia PS, police reached to the spot but police failed to trace the thieves.

The theft incident in a row twice in a month has created panic in the area.
